*Keynote Speaker will be Joanne Denworth, a land use and environmental lawyer, who has been working in Pennsylvania Governor Ed Rendell's Office of Policy since March, 2003. She works with state agencies on policy issues relating to land use, including community and economic development, environmental protection, parks and conservation, transportation, water and sewer infrastructure, agriculture, historic preservation, and recreation.
